  • Beryllium copper - Wikipedia

    Properties. Beryllium copper is a ductile, weldable, and machinable alloy. Like pure copper, it is resistant to non-oxidizing acids like hydrochloric acid and carbonic acid, to plastic decomposition products, to abrasive wear, and to galling.It can be heat-treated for increased strength, durability, and electrical conductivity.Beryllium copper attains the greatest strength (to 1,400 MPa ...

  • Beryllium Copper - Official Site of Copper Development ...

    Beryllium Copper Overview. Copper beryllium alloys are used for their high strength and good electrical and thermal conductivities. There are two groups of copper beryllium alloys, high strength alloys and high conductivity alloys. The wrought high strength alloys contain 1.6 to 2.0% beryllium and approximately 0.3% cobalt.

  • Beryllium - Overview | Occupational Safety and Health ...

    Beryllium is used industrially in three forms: as a pure metal, as beryllium oxide, and most commonly, as an alloy with copper, aluminum, magnesium, or nickel. Beryllium oxide (called beryllia) is known for its high heat capacity and is an important component of certain sensitive electronic equipment.

  • AT0016 0311 Resistance Welding Copper Beryllium

    Resistance Welding Copper Beryllium Electric resistance welding (RW) is a reliable, low cost, efficient method of permanently joining two or more thin pieces of metal. Although RW is a true welding process, no filler metal or protective gases are required. There is no excess metal to remove after welding.

  • Guide to Copper Beryllium - Matthey

    Copper beryllium high strength alloys are less dense than conventional specialty coppers, often providing more pieces per pound of input material. Copper beryllium also has an elastic modulus 10 to 20 percent higher than other specialty copper alloys. Strength, resilience, and elastic properties make copper beryllium the alloy of choice.
